#392094 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#392094 is composed of 22.4% red, 12.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 78.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 35.3%. #392094 color hex could be obtained by blending #7240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#392094 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#392094 has RGB values of R:57, G:32,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3743892.

Shades and Tints of #392094
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f4f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#392094
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59575d is the less saturated color, while #2904b0 is the most saturated one.
